A dynamic SaaS company is seeking a Senior Client Partner to drive revenue-focused partnerships. This hands-on role requires building and executing partnership strategies, generating leads, and negotiating terms.
The ideal candidate has experience in commercial partnerships within the B2B SaaS sector and possesses strong negotiation and stakeholder management skills.
This position offers a flexible hybrid working environment in London and a strong benefits package.

How to prepare for a job interview at Sphere Digital Recruitment Group
✨Know Your SaaS Stuff
Make sure you brush up on the latest trends and challenges in the B2B SaaS sector. Being able to discuss industry specifics will show that you're not just a candidate, but someone who understands the landscape and can drive revenue-focused partnerships effectively.
✨Showcase Your Negotiation Skills
Prepare examples of past negotiations where you successfully secured beneficial terms for your company. Highlighting these experiences will demonstrate your capability in handling complex discussions and stakeholder management, which is crucial for this role.
✨Have a Partnership Strategy Ready
Think about potential partnership strategies you could implement if you were in the role. Presenting a well-thought-out plan during the interview will not only impress them but also show your proactive approach to driving revenue.
✨Ask Insightful Questions
Prepare thoughtful questions about their current partnerships and future goals. This sh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you gauge how you can contribute to their success in the long run.
